2,000+ travel companies
2,000+ travel companies
Scan to get our free app
Use our app to get live travel updates and book mobile tickets for trains, buses, flights, and ferries.
App Store
42K ratings
Google Play
136K reviews
Journey information
Overview: Train from Lesja to Straumsnes
Trains from Lesja to Straumsnes run on average 1 times per day, taking around 23h 21m. Cheap train tickets for this journey start at $143 (€116) if you book in advance.
The earliest train runs at 16:41, the last at 16:41. The fastest train covers the 403 miles (649 km) distance in 23h 21m.
Fares are the lowest economy prices found on Omio. Early booking often means lower prices. Prices change daily and are subject to availability. Discount cards, coach trips, and booking fees are not included.
Price information
Distance 403 miles (649 km) |
Average train duration 23h 21m |
Cheapest ticket price $143 (€116) |
Trains per day 1 |
Fastest train 23h 21m |
First train 16:41 |
Last train 16:41 |
Fares are the lowest economy prices found on Omio. Early booking often means lower prices. Prices change daily and are subject to availability. Discount cards, coach trips, and booking fees are not included.
Price information
Train companies: Sj Nord from Lesja to Straumsnes trainsSj Nord trains will get you between Lesja and Straumsnes from $143 (€116). With over 1000 travel companies on Omio, you can find the best train times and tickets for your trip.
Sj Nord
Luggage & cancellation policy
Average Duration
23h 27m
Cheapest Price
$202 (€164)
Sj Nord frequency
1 a day
FAQs: Trains from Lesja to Straumsnes
Find answers to the most common questions about traveling from Lesja to Straumsnes by train. From journey times and ticket prices to direct connections, first and last departures, and even whether the route is scenic, our FAQs cover everything you need to plan your trip. Whether you’re looking for the fastest train, the cheapest option, or tips for making the most of your visit at Straumsnes, this guide helps you travel smarter and with confidence.

Train ticket prices from Lesja to Straumsnes can vary. The cheapest ticket starts at $143 (€116), while the average price is around $143 (€116).
The train from Lesja to Straumsnes runs once a day and takes approximately 23h 21m.
The first train from Lesja to Straumsnes leaves at 4:41 PM.
The distance by train from Lesja to Straumsnes is 403 miles (649 km).
The last train from Lesja to Straumsnes leaves at 4:41 PM.
There is no high speed train available from Lesja to Straumsnes.
There is no direct train service currently available from Lesja to Straumsnes.
Unfortunately, there is no night train available from Lesja to Straumsnes.
The cheapest way to get from Lesja to Straumsnes is by train, with a cost of around $143 (€116).
Yes, the train journey from Lesja to Straumsnes is scenic, offering picturesque views of the Norwegian countryside, including mountains, forests, and rivers.
A day trip from Lesja to Straumsnes is not feasible as the journey duration is 23h 21m and the distance is 403 miles (649 km). The frequency is once per day for trains.
To fully enjoy the scenic beauty and outdoor activities of Straumsnes, plan to spend about 2 to 3 days.
Yes, you can take the train from Lesja to Straumsnes.
popular train stations
Popular train stations from Lesja to Straumsnes
Lesja
Straumsnes
The major train station for departures in Lesja is Lesja. Find all the information you need to know about services, amenities and connections at Lesja for your trip from Lesja to Straumsnes.
Lesja
Amenities at train station
information
The major train station for arrivals in Straumsnes is Valnesfjord. Find all the information you need to know about services, amenities and connections at Valnesfjord for your journey to Straumsnes from Lesja.
Valnesfjord
Amenities at train station
information
